Hello

I want to know if is possible to use EAN13 codes from a barcode scanner to insert lines in the inventory.

I have a text file with a list of EAN13 code and the quantity. I export an example to a stock.inventory.csv file for use as template for import but this file uses the product name or product internal code instead of the EAN13 to locate each item.

There is otherway of doing this? what I miss?

I don't know in OpenERP 7, but in 6.0, I've created a little script which browse lines of your csv file and create stock_move according to difference between current real stock quantity in database and in the warehouse, like when you change manualy the stock (by clicking on update quantity button on product form view)

Well, then I'll use a similar workaround. I can get the barcode scanner data in a csv spreadsheet and then cross reference the EAN13 codes with the csv exported from the warehouse to get the internal codes (I really have a libreoffice basic script for this). Thanks!!!
